This place is a little gem hidden in the Atlas mountains. The village is the ideal place for relaxing, far from the chaos of cars and cities. We suggest travelers to spend here at least two nights, and take advantage of excursions and trekkings that can be arranged by the hotel (special thanks to Hassan who guided us through the mountains, inside a cave and cooked us a delicious barbeque in the wilds). The host Laarbi was very nice and welcoming, and he also helped us in organising the rest of our Moroccan trip.

The location was extraordinary, nestled on a hill amidst the authentic Zaouia of Sidi Hamza. The place was true to Amazigh architecture, decoration, cuisine, and hospitality. It was like traveling back in time: the peace, the quiet, the wild beauty of the mountains, and the warmth of the people. Laarbi was a fantastic host who readily shared stories about his culture, his travels, and his projects for the village with a delightful humorous twist. Our promenade within the zaouia with him is a treasured memory. We will definitely come back again for a longer stay this time.

If you want a luxurious experience, that is not it. There is no TV or AC and the commodities they do have might not be the height of modernity but they function. The Zaouia is pretty far off the main road from Midelt and it is not the smoothest ride to get there but it is worth it if what you seek is one of the most authentic and human experiences you can find in Morocco today.
